Hand-built vintage tone in a small, easy to carry and listen to package. This is a re-creation of one of the most popular and widely played guitar amplifiers -- The Fender 1956 Tweed Deluxe. Using 6V6 power tubes, a 12 inch speaker, and 5Y3 tube rectifier, this amp is excellent for at-home use, small club venues and is one of the most-used amps in rock-and-roll recording studios around the world. You can find Fender Deluxe's and amps like them in clubs the world over and frequently used with a microphone on concert stages in front of thousands (thanks Neil, great tone!).
